The Chicago Department of Aviation (CDA), along with Unibail-Rodamco-Westfield (URW) Airports and concession partners, held a ribbon-cutting ceremony to mark the opening of The Dearborn restaurant in O’Hare International Airport’s renovated Terminal 5.

The Dearborn, which first opened in Chicago’s theater district in 2016 by sisters Amy and Clodagh Lawless, now offers sit-down dining and a grab-and-go marketplace for travelers at the airport. The expansion brings local Chicago flavors to one of the world’s busiest airports.

“On behalf of Mayor Brandon Johnson and the entire City of Chicago, I am proud to welcome a world-class Chicago eatery like The Dearborn to our world-class airport,” CDA Commissioner Michael J. McMurray said. “Owned and operated by two sisters from Galway with deep roots in Chicago’s hospitality industry, The Dearborn brings more than just great food to O’Hare – it brings the warm, welcoming experience that has made it a beloved institution in the Loop for nearly a decade.”

Brian Petrow, URW’s Vice President ORD and Airport Operations, stated: “Bringing a beloved local brand like The Dearborn to Terminal 5 is a perfect example of our mission in action. Celebrated for capturing the spirit of one of Chicago’s most vibrant neighborhoods with a diverse menu to offer something for every traveler, The Dearborn also exemplifies the kind of inclusive growth we strive for—a local female-owned business in partnership with a local, minority operator. We’re proud to support the CDA’s vision and excited to help shape the next chapter of the terminal’s expansion.”

The restaurant is operated by HOST AIR ORD FB, which is a joint venture between John Wober—President of Airbrands—and HMSHost. Airbrands is fully certified as an Airport Concessions Disadvantaged Business Enterprise (ACDBE).

"HMSHost, URW, the City of Chicago, and the Lawless sisters embody the partnerships that make this airport and city special," said John Wober. "Opening The Dearborn at O’Hare is especially meaningful as the son of parents who first touched down here from Argentina."

Clodagh Lawless commented on their new location: “Growing The Dearborn into this incredible new location is a dream come true and a defining moment for our journey as restaurateurs. Since opening our doors in the Loop, we’ve poured our hearts into creating a space that reflects the soul of Chicago—its people, its flavors, and its hospitality. To now bring that same spirit to the international stage at O’Hare is deeply meaningful. We are proud to share what we’ve built with travelers from all over the world and to continue expanding the reach of our family’s story and Chicago’s dynamic food culture.”

Amy Lawless added: “We are incredibly grateful for the opportunity to showcase everything The Dearborn stands for—heartfelt hospitality, delicious food, and a sense of community—right in the heart of one of the world’s busiest airports. As a female-owned, immigrant-founded restaurant, this expansion not only represents growth for our business but also the power of inclusive progress and partnership. We’re honored to represent Chicago in this exciting new chapter at Terminal 5 and are thrilled to work alongside our partners to deliver a warm, welcoming experience to every traveler who walks through our doors.”

The menu includes items such as Fish & Chips featured on Beat Bobby Flay; Midwest Fried Chicken Wings; DB Smash Burger made with dry-aged CDK Farms beef; Buffalo Chicken Sandwich; Japanese Curry Poutine; Dearborn Protein Bowl; tavern-style pizza; among other options.

Longtime Executive Chef Aaron Cuschieri has been promoted to Chef Partner as part of this expansion. He will lead menu development at O’Hare while continuing his role at The Dearborn's original location.
